Vocal Rest: Giving Your Voice a Break Resting your voice is a key strategy among remedies when losing your voice. This means speaking less and avoiding whispering, which can strain the vocal cords more than speaking at a normal volume. Humidify Your Environment Using a humidifier can help soothe and heal your vocal cords faster. Maintaining the right humidity level in your environment is an effective remedy when losing your voice, as it helps prevent further irritation.
